A privilege escalation flaw was found in the Xorg-x11-server due to a lack
of authentication for X11 clients. This flaw allows an attacker to take
control of an X application by impersonating the server it is expecting to
connect to.

Notes

Author Note
mdeslaur as of 2021-05-19, there is no upstream fix for this issue. This is a long-standing X11 design limitation and is difficult to exploit. We will not be releasing updates for this issue.
